6.0 Powerstroke Bleeding Instructions

To bleed the fuel system on a 6.0 Powerstroke engine, follow these step-by-step instructions:

1. Start by removing the fuel filter from the engine. Fill the new fuel filter with diesel fuel before installing it back into the engine.

2. Locate the fuel drain valve on the fuel filter housing. Open the valve to allow any air in the fuel system to escape. Let the fuel drain until there is no air bubbles visible in the fuel.

3. Once the fuel is flowing smoothly without any air bubbles, close the fuel drain valve.

4. Use a priming pump or hand pump to prime the fuel system. Continue pumping until you see fuel flowing steadily through the system.

5. Check for any leaks in the fuel system and tighten any connections if necessary.

6. Start the engine and let it run for a few minutes to ensure that the fuel system is properly bled and the engine is running smoothly.

Bleeding Air from Powerstroke Fuel System

Air bubbles in the fuel system can cause issues such as rough idling, loss of power, and poor fuel economy. Bleeding air from the Powerstroke fuel system is a simple yet crucial maintenance task that should be performed regularly to keep the engine running smoothly.

Ford Powerstroke Bleeding Gas

When bleeding the fuel system of a Ford Powerstroke engine, it is important to use diesel fuel and not gasoline. Using gasoline can damage the engine and its components. Always use the recommended type of fuel when performing maintenance tasks on your Powerstroke engine.
